			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tweetmeme_button" style="float: right; margin-left: 10px; color:#cc5006;"><a href="http://api.tweetmeme.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.theinsoundfromwayout.com%2F2011%2F10%2Fgorillaz-turn-the-big-1-0%2F"><img src="http://api.tweetmeme.com/imagebutton.gif?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.theinsoundfromwayout.com%2F2011%2F10%2Fgorillaz-turn-the-big-1-0%2F" height="61" width="51" /></a></div><p>Ten years ago, a Brit pop legend and a comic book genius joined brains and gave birth to one of the coolest musical collectives to ever set a virtual foot on this planet. Gorillaz are a bunch of toons brought to life by stunning anime style animation, fascinating fictional narratives and pure musical brilliance&#8230;.  the &#8220;first virtual hip-hop group&#8221; of our time. Three incredible albums later, and we&#8217;re celebrating their 10th birthday.</p>
<p>So does 10 years of great hits call for a greatest hits? Of course it does. To celebrate ten years of the Gorillaz,<strong> <a href="http://gorillaz.com/">The Singles Collection: 2001-2011</a></strong> will be released on November 25th, 2011. <strong> </strong>A 15-track collection of the band’s singles, videos and remixes, The Singles Collection celebrates 10 years of audio visual innovation and three studio albums from the most successful virtual band in the world ever.  The Singles Collection will be released as a standard CD, CD and DVD and 140 gram vinyl.  A special edition 7” box set will also be made available.</p>
<p>Always open to a mind-blowing collaboration, Gorillaz have worked with Del the Funkee Homosapien, De La Soul, Kano, Mick Jones, Bobby Womack, Ike Turner, Lou Reed, Mark E Smith, Bootie Brown, Tina Weymouth, Bashy, Little Dragon, Hypnotic Brass Ensemble, Snoop Dogg, Dangermouse, Ibrahim Ferrer, Dan The Automator, Mos Def, D12, Phi Life Cypher, MF Doom, Rosie Wilson, Shaun Ryder and Neneh Cherry.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tweetmeme_button" style="float: right; margin-left: 10px; color:#cc5006;"><a href="http://api.tweetmeme.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.theinsoundfromwayout.com%2F2011%2F01%2Fgorillaz-the-fall-download%2F"><img src="http://api.tweetmeme.com/imagebutton.gif?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.theinsoundfromwayout.com%2F2011%2F01%2Fgorillaz-the-fall-download%2F" height="61" width="51" /></a></div><p>Still reeling from last year&#8217;s magnificent Gorillaz Australian shows? Need some headphone fodder to help rekindle the experience, but you&#8217;ve listened to <em>Plastic Beach</em> 293 times already?</p>
<p>Thankfully those pathologically productive Gorillaz boys have recorded an album on the road and it&#8217;s ready for you to download in full. As promised by Damon &amp; co, <em>The Fall</em> was recorded and mixed with 20+ various iPad Apps whilst on tour in the USA during October and November 2010.</p>

<p>Gorillaz played two nights at the world-renowned arena, one on Sunday night (14 Nov) and again on Tuesday (16 Nov). I&#8217;m told however that the wide-reaching grasp of The In Sound From Way Out has conspired to give me some competition &#8211; namely in a fellow UK correspondent! *queue dramatic music*</p>
<p>Therefore if this review falls short of my fellow Briton&#8217;s then I can only blame our simian friends for playing a better show on Sunday. Surely the only explanation!</p>
<p>The show opened with the sweeping orchestral introduction to the album, and then straight in to <a href="http://www.theinsoundfromwayout.com/2010/03/gorillaz-plastic-beach-review-asha/" target="_self"><em>Welcome To The World Of The Plastic Beach</em></a> with Snoop adorning the huge screen behind the stage.</p>
<p><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-12640" title="Gorillaz, live at the O2 Arena, London" src="http://www.theinsoundfromwayout.com/wp-content/uploads/gorillaz-o2.jpg" alt="Gorillaz, live at the O2 Arena, London" width="520" height="350" /></p>
<p>The vast majority of other album collaborators were available on the night though, Including Bobby Womack, Mos Def, Daley, Mark E Smith and Little Dragon (<a href="http://news.little-dragon.se/" target="_blank">in Oz for sideshows this December</a>). Highlight for me was Womack&#8217;s soaring vocals on <a href="http://www.theinsoundfromwayout.com/2010/02/gorillaz-stylo-trailer-metric-remix/" target="_self"><em>Stylo</em></a>&#8230; amazing.</p>
<p>From previous albums all the big hitters were out &#8211; <em>Kids With Guns</em>, <em>Feel Good Inc</em> and <em>19-2000</em> among others. Overall the live show is impressive &#8211; a huge collection of musicians coming together to pull it off, doing so in style and in force. Videos and animations accompanied the entire set, providing a feast of musical delights for the gathered crowd.</p>

<p>Gorillaz, the brainchild of musical genius Damon Albarn and the artistic brilliance of Jamie Hewlett have sold close to ½ a million albums and DVDs in Australia and this December will embark on their <a href="http://www.theinsoundfromwayout.com/2010/07/gorillaz-oz-tour/" target="_self">first stadium tour of Australia and NZ</a> which will see them play to more than 60,000 people.</p>
<p>The Gorillaz live band includes Damon Albarn, Mick Jones and Paul Simonon (The Clash), Mike Smith, Cass Browne, Jeff Wootton and Gabriel Manuals Wallace, as well as additional backing singers, brass sections and a full string ensemble.  Confirmed special guests on their Australasian jaunt include De La Soul, Hypnotic Brass, Bobby Womack, the Syrian National Orchestra of Arabic Music, Bootie Brown, Little Dragon and Rosile Wilson.
